Manama: The Vibrant Capital
Manama, the bustling capital of Bahrain, stands as a testament to the nation's rich history and modern aspirations. This dynamic city is where tradition meets innovation, offering a captivating blend of old-world charm and contemporary flair. From its ancient souks to its towering skyscrapers, Manama encapsulates the spirit of Bahrain, inviting visitors to immerse themselves in its vibrant culture and experience its warm hospitality.
At the heart of Manama lies the iconic Bab Al Bahrain, a historical landmark that serves as the gateway to the city's vibrant souks. Here, amidst the labyrinthine alleyways, you can discover a treasure trove of traditional crafts, spices, perfumes, and textiles. The air is filled with the aroma of exotic spices and the sounds of merchants haggling over prices, creating an authentic sensory experience that transports you back in time. Beyond the souks, Manama boasts a stunning waterfront promenade, where you can stroll along the Corniche and admire the city's glittering skyline. The Bahrain National Museum offers a fascinating glimpse into the country's rich history and cultural heritage, while the Al Fateh Grand Mosque stands as a magnificent example of Islamic architecture.
Manama is also a hub of modern commerce and entertainment, with a plethora of luxury hotels, world-class restaurants, and trendy cafes. The city's vibrant nightlife scene offers something for everyone, from rooftop bars with panoramic views to traditional Arabic music venues. Whether you're a history buff, a foodie, or a shopaholic, Manama has something to captivate your senses and leave you with unforgettable memories. As you wander through the city's streets, you'll encounter a diverse tapestry of cultures and traditions, reflecting Bahrain's cosmopolitan identity. From the traditional Bahraini houses in the old quarters to the modern art galleries showcasing local talent, Manama is a city that celebrates its heritage while embracing the future.
Muharraq: The Historical Gem
Muharraq, the former capital of Bahrain, is a city steeped in history and tradition. This enchanting island city offers a glimpse into Bahrain's rich past, with its well-preserved historical architecture, ancient landmarks, and vibrant cultural scene. As you wander through the narrow streets of Muharraq, you'll be transported back in time, discovering the stories and secrets of this captivating city.
One of Muharraq's most iconic landmarks is the Arad Fort, a 15th-century fortress that stands as a testament to the island's strategic importance throughout history. Explore the fort's ramparts and towers, imagining the battles and sieges that once took place within its walls. The fort offers stunning views of the surrounding coastline and serves as a reminder of Bahrain's maritime heritage. Muharraq is also home to the Shaikh Isa bin Ali House, a beautifully restored traditional Bahraini house that offers a glimpse into the life of a wealthy merchant family in the 19th century. Admire the intricate architecture, the elegant courtyards, and the traditional furnishings that reflect the city's rich cultural heritage.
The city's traditional souks are a treasure trove of local crafts, spices, and textiles, where you can haggle for souvenirs and immerse yourself in the authentic atmosphere. Muharraq is also known for its vibrant arts scene, with numerous galleries and studios showcasing the work of local artists. The city hosts a variety of cultural events and festivals throughout the year, celebrating Bahrain's heritage and traditions. As you explore Muharraq, be sure to sample the local cuisine, which is a delicious blend of Arabic, Persian, and Indian flavors. From traditional Bahraini dishes to fresh seafood delicacies, Muharraq offers a culinary experience that is sure to tantalize your taste buds. Whether you're a history enthusiast, an art lover, or a foodie, Muharraq has something to offer everyone.
